How Much Do Special Education Graduates from Malone University Make?

$37,473 Bachelor's Median Salary

Salary of Special Education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

Special Education majors who earn their bachelor’s degree from Malone University go on to jobs where they make a median salary of $37,473 a year. This is lower than $53,927, the median for all majors at Malone University.

Malone University Special Education Bachelor’s Program Diversity

Every one of the 8 students who graduated with a bachelor’s degree in special education from Malone University identified as women.

Malone University gender breakdown of Special Education Bachelor's degree grads

The majority of special education bachelor’s degree graduates at Malone University were White. Approximately 88% of graduates fell into this category.
